However, in China, the enterprises breaking through the law are mainly penalized for the administrative liabilities, focusing less on the civil compensation liability on the environmental damage and criminal liabilities on the environmental crimes.
Nevertheless, a complete environmental liability system is composed by administrative punishment, civil compensation and criminal sanction, none of which is dispensable.

Therefore, we identified multiple risk factors of falls based on a systematic literature review and then developed a new questionnaire - the Senior Citizen Risk of Falling Check.
A group of 117 residents (average age 82.9 years, range 68.2-98.2 years, 83.8% women), all without care needs (assessed by the German health and care insurance system) returned the Senior Citizen Risk of Falling Check.
